Q: Is 481,510 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 481,510 is a composite number.

Why is 481,510 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 481,510 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 179 269 358 538 895 1,345 1,790 2,690 48,151 96,302 240,755 and 481,510, with no remainder.

Since 481,510 cannot be divided by just 1 and 481,510, it is a composite number.
